"Suspicious" toilet pumped as search for  missing eight month old boy enters third day

Siam Rath reported that an army of press descended on a house in the Bang Leng district of Nakhon Pathom, central Thailand, after a young couple posted on Facebook that their 8 month old son had gone missing under mysterious circumstances.

 

Provincial police deputy Pol Col Phallop Suriyakulon na Ayutthaya ordered the area sealed off along with a house behind where relatives live.

 

He spoke to Sitthichoke or "Phut", 19 and his wife Pilaiporn, 16, the mother of the child.

Checks were made on a wardrobe in the bedroom then it was noticed that a squat toilet had been surrounded by cement.

 

This aroused suspicions in the police.

 

An elder sister who owns the house said she had put the cement in herself because there had been a bad smell welling up from the toilet.

Police asked for permission to smash the cement and a thirty minute suction of the toilet began.

 

This failed to turn up anything untoward.

The toilet was resealed and the police left at 6.30 pm as the mystery disappearance entered its third day.

 

CCTV in the area had yielded no leads.

 

Earlier sniffer dogs had been used to try and locate the child.
